Bar-B-Q Spaghetti
Makes 6 to 8 servings
Ingredients
- 1 (16-ounce) bottle Dancing Pigs Original Bar-B-Q Sauce* or other tangy tomato-based barbecue sauce
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 cup chopped onion
- ¾ cup chopped green bell pepper
- ½ cup vegetable oil
- 2 tablespoons liquid smoke
- Dash of salt
- 1 (16-ounce) package spaghetti noodles
- 2 pounds shredded smoked pork shoulder
Instructions
- In a large skillet, bring barbecue sauce, sugar, onion, bell pepper, oil, liquid smoke, and salt to bo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at, and simmer, stirring frequently, for 30 minutes.
- Bring a large pot of water to a boil over medium-high heat; add pasta, and cook, stirring occasionally, for 15 minutes. Drain pasta, and top with sauce and pork. Serve immediately.
